ACW-25 is a medium weight aluminized protective fabric engineered for PPE and protective equipment used in environments with radiant heat and molten metal splash exposure. The material combines a flexible, durable aluminized front-side with a soft carbon and aramid woven back-side, providing excellent heat protection, flexibility, and durability without the stiffness often associated with fiberglass-based constructions. Certified to EN ISO 11612 with ratings of A1, B1, C4, D3, E3, and F1, ACW-25 is also REACH compliant and RoHS-10 compliant, with an operating temperature range of -40°F to 356°F (-40°C to 180°C). ACW-25 is a strong material choice for high-performance protective covers, shields, and PPE used in demanding thermal protection application.

Specifications

  • REACH: Compliant
  • Maximum Operating Temperature: 356°F
  • Minimum Operating Temperature: -40°F
  • RoHS: RoHS-10
  • Shelf Life: 60 Months
  • Flame Propagation: A1 (EN ISO 11612)
  • Convective Heat Resistance: B1 (EN ISO 11612)
  • Radiant Heat Resistance: C4 (EN ISO 11612)
  • Molten Aluminum Splash Resistance: D3 (EN ISO 11612)
  • Molten Steel Splash Resistance: E3 (EN ISO 11612)
  • Contact Heat Resistance: F1 (EN ISO 11612)
  • Thickness: 0.025”
